Drama
Even though I don’t know you, I can guarantee that you have been a part of, or experienced Drama. I know that, going to public school made it impossible for me escape it. Public Schools are full of drama but that isn’t the only place that drama resides. Drama is a part of work, Christian schools, gyms, churches. Anywhere someone knows someone else. In work places and school drama is what it is. It is people creating little situations in to huge ones. It is people gossiping about things that they know nothing about. However in churches, I think that drama and gossiping is disguised. Often times I think that people will take a situation and turn it into a prayer request so that they are able to freely talk about other people with out feeling guilty. The situation does indeed need to be prayed about often times. But some of the members of the church take great joy in being able to tell other people about the things that fellow Christians are doing wrong, or the juicy details in a scandals event. Things like that can easily ruin a church. It is the simple things like this that slowly creep up on us. Often we don’t realize it is happening until there is a major blowout that causes severe damage. I often have to check myself when I want to share a request. I ask my self what details need to be shared in order for it to be effectively prayed out. And my true intentions in giving the details that I do.
